Which one of the following impurities present in colloidal solution cannot be removed by electrodialysis?

Answer»

SODIUM chloride
Potassium SULPHATE
Urea
CALCIUM chloride

SOLUTION :Electrodialysisinvolvesmovementofionstowardsoppositelychargedelectrodes.
Ureabeingacovalentcompounddoes notdissociatetogiveionsand hence itcannotberemovedby ELECTRODIALYSIS. Howeverallthe other given compoundsareionicwhichcanundergodissociation to giveoppositelychargedionsandthuscanbeseparated.
